Some abusers of fentanyl may apply heat to a fentanyl patch in order to release its effects rapidly. Increased diffusion of the drug due to exposure to heat sources or elevated body temperature can result in side effects and may even result in death.

Some effects of the patch will continue for 18 hours after it is removed since the medicine has already been absorbed into the skin. The used patch still contains enough fentanyl to cause serious harm, even kill a child or pet, so fold it in half with the sticky sides together and discard properly.
